Government Bailout Prevention Act

Last updated: 5/21/2026 · Introduced: 5/21/2026

Author: Todd Young (R-IN)

TL;DR (AI)

  • This bill prohibits the federal government from using funds to purchase or guarantee obligations of financially distressed state and local governments, including those at risk of default, starting January 1, 2026.
  • The bill restricts the Treasury and Federal Reserve from providing financial assistance to governments facing financial distress, with exceptions for disaster relief.
  • This legislation excludes discretionary appropriations, direct spending, and grants awarded to governmental entities from the prohibition on federal financial assistance.
